2018 STATE OF WYOMING 18LSO-0087 ENGROSSED 2.1 HOUSE BILL NO. HB0027 Continuing teacher contracts for military spouses. Sponsored by: Joint Education Interim Committee A BILL for AN ACT relating to teacher contracts; providing accelerated continuing contract status for teachers who are surviving spouses of veterans or are married to military members; and providing for an effective date. Be It Enacted by the Legislature of the State of Wyoming: Section 1 . W.S. 21 ‑ 7 ‑ 102(a) (ii) (A), (B) and by creating a new subparagraph (C) is amended to read : 21 ‑ 7 ‑ 102 . Definitions. (a) As used in this article the following definitions shall apply: (ii) "Continuing Contract Teacher": (A) Any initial contract teacher who has been employed by the same school district in the state of Wyoming for a period of three (3) consecutive school years, has had his contract renewed for a fourth consecutive school year and, beginning school year 2019 ‑ 2020 and each school year thereafter, has performed satisfactorily on performance evaluations implemented by the district under W.S. 21 ‑ 3 ‑ 110(a)(xvii) during this period of time; or (B) A teacher who has achieved continuing contract status in one (1) district, and who without lapse of time has taught two (2) consecutive school years and has had his contract renewed for a third consecutive school year by the employing school district, and, beginning school year 2019 ‑ 2020 and each school year thereafter, has performed satisfactorily on performance evaluations conducted by both districts under W.S. 21 ‑ 3 ‑ 110(a)(xvii) during this period of time ; . or ( C ) Any initial contract teacher who: (I) Is a surviving spouse, as defined in W.S. 19 ‑ 14 ‑ 102(d)(iii), or t he spouse of a full ‑ time member of the armed forces of the United States ; (II) T aught three (3) school years in the preceding six (6) school years in any accredited school district, regardless of location , and who without lapse of time has taught two (2) consecut ive school years in the employing Wyoming school district and has had his contract renewed for a third consecutive school year by the employing Wyoming school district ; and (III) B eginning school year 2019 ‑ 2020 and each school year thereafter, during th e periods of time referred to in subdivision (II) of this subparagraph , p erformed satisfactorily on per formance evaluations conducted by the employing school district in Wyoming under W.S. 21 ‑ 3 ‑ 110(a)(xvii) and a ny accredited school district in another jurisdiction under a statute or rule similar to W.S. 21 ‑ 3 ‑ 110(a)(xvii). Section 2 . This act is effective July 1, 201 8 . (END) 1 HB0027
